Let's Get Digital, Newcastle is a project to help local people get the digital skills they need for everyday life. These skills are essential for almost everything now, from applying for jobs and benefits to paying for parking. But more than a third of us have "low" or "very low" digital skills and struggle to thrive in a digital-first world.

The most effective and sustainable way to help people get these skills is via organisations they already know and trust. So we're offering training and support to local organisations, to turn their staff or volunteers into confident skilled Digital Champions who can then help others with digital skills.

The offer for organisations in Newcastle

Thanks to our sponsors, Capgemini, we can offer community organisations...

  • Free membership of the Digital Champions Network, with licences for up to 10 staff and volunteers to join the Network and train as Digital Champions.
  • Access to 25+ CPD certified training courses, backed up hundreds of curated, updated resources, tech guides, session plans and training tips.  
  • Built-in Project Management tools to help you track your Champions' training.
  • Easy-to-use reporting tools to show what your Champions have achieved.
  • A friendly community of practice for Champions and Project Managers to share ideas and challenges.
  • A dedicated Let's Get Digital, Newcastle co-ordinator to help you get your project going and link you up with other digital schemes and opportunities across the county.

Who can apply?

The offer is open to community organisations and groups in Newcastle.

You don't need to be a digitally focused organisation but you do need to want to help people with digital skills. You should not be already connected to our sponsor Capgemini. If you'd like to apply but aren't sure you qualify, just get in touch with Kate.
